About Hedra
Hedra is a pioneering generative media company backed by top investors at Index, A16Z, and Abstract Ventures. We're building Hedra Studio, a multimodal creation platform capable of control, emotion, and creative intelligence.
At the core of Hedra Studio is our Character-3 foundation model, the first omnimodal model in production. Character-3 jointly reasons across image, text, and audio for more intelligent video generation — it’s the next evolution of AI-driven content creation.

Overview
We are seeking a Research Scientist to lead innovation in video generation distillation, including step distillation, model size reduction, and efficient inference methods. This role focuses on making state-of-the-art video diffusion models faster, lighter, and more deployable without sacrificing quality. The ideal candidate will be experienced in model compression techniques and capable of bridging cutting-edge research with production needs.
Responsibilities
Research and develop distillation techniques for video diffusion models, including step distillation, layer pruning, and knowledge transfer.
Optimize models for latency, memory footprint, and energy efficiency while maintaining high generation quality.
Collaborate with engineering to implement and benchmark accelerated inference pipelines.
Monitor and evaluate advancements in model compression, quantization, and efficient generative modeling.
Present findings to the team and contribute to publications or patents where applicable.
Qualifications
PhD or strong industry experience in Machine Learning, with a focus on model compression, distillation, or efficient deep learning.
Strong understanding of diffusion models and their training/inference workflows.
Proficiency in Python and PyTorch; familiarity with performance profiling and optimization.
Experience with quantization, pruning, and low-rank adaptation techniques is a plus.
A record of impactful work in model efficiency, either in research or production.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ene
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
-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
-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
